What Is an Automatic Urinal Flush System?
An automatic urinal flush system is a touch-free flushing mechanism that uses sensors to detect user movement. Once the user steps away, the sensor triggers the flush automatically.
These systems are common in:
- Airports
- Hospitals
- Shopping malls
- Hotels
- Office buildings
- Restaurants
Most sensor-operated flush valves use:
- Infrared sensors
- Battery-powered electronics
- Hardwired electrical systems
- Programmable flush timing
The main purpose of automatic flushing is to improve hygiene while reducing unnecessary water use.
What Is a Manual Urinal Flush Valve?
A manual flush valve requires physical interaction to activate flushing. Users typically push a button or pull a handle after use.
Manual systems remain common in:
- Small retail stores
- Older office buildings
- Budget-focused facilities
- Low-traffic commercial bathrooms
These systems are mechanically simple and usually cost less to install. However, they depend on user behavior, which can create sanitation and water waste issues.
How Do Automatic and Manual Urinal Flush Systems Work?
The biggest difference between automatic and manual systems is activation.
| Feature | Automatic Flush | Manual Flush |
| Activation | Motion sensor | Handle/button |
| User Contact | None | Required |
| Water Control | Sensor-timed | User-dependent |
| Power Source | Battery or electrical | Mechanical |
| Hygiene Level | High | Moderate |
Automatic systems use electronic sensors to monitor restroom usage. When movement stops, the valve opens and flushes for a programmed duration.
Manual systems use mechanical pressure valves controlled directly by users.
This operational difference affects hygiene, maintenance, and water efficiency.

Which Option Saves More Water and Reduces Utility Costs?
Water conservation is one of the biggest reasons businesses upgrade to automatic flush systems.
Automatic valves use programmed flushing cycles to prevent:
- Double flushing
- Continuous flushing
- Missed flushing
- Excess water usage
Manual systems often waste water because users may:
- Hold the handle too long
- Flush multiple times
- Forget to flush completely
Many sensor-operated systems support low-flow technology and WaterSense standards.

What Are the Installation and Maintenance Differences?
Automatic systems usually require:
- Electrical connections or batteries
- Sensor calibration
- Periodic battery replacement
- More advanced troubleshooting
Manual systems require:
- Basic plumbing installation
- Mechanical part replacement
- Minimal technical maintenance
| Maintenance Factor | Automatic Flush | Manual Flush |
| Installation Complexity | Moderate | Simple |
| Electrical Requirement | Yes | No |
| Battery Replacement | Sometimes | No |
| Sensor Calibration | Required | Not required |
| Mechanical Wear | Lower | Higher |
Manual flush valves are easier to repair because they contain fewer electronic components.
However, automatic systems often reduce overall cleaning demands because they improve restroom cleanliness and consistency.

Are Smart Sensor Flush Systems the Future of Commercial Restrooms?
Commercial restrooms are becoming smarter and more connected.
Modern sensor flush systems can integrate with:
- Smart building platforms
- Water monitoring systems
- Occupancy analytics
- Maintenance alerts
These technologies help facility managers:
- Track water consumption
- Detect leaks faster
- Improve maintenance scheduling
- Reduce operating costs
As touchless technology becomes more common, automatic flush systems will likely continue growing across commercial industries.

Frequently Asked Questions
Are automatic urinal flush systems worth it?
Yes. In high-traffic commercial buildings, automatic flush systems often reduce water waste and improve hygiene enough to justify the higher upfront investment.
Do automatic flush valves save water?
Yes. Sensor-operated systems help prevent over-flushing and unnecessary water use through timed flushing cycles.
Can manual urinal flush valves be upgraded to automatic?
In many cases, yes. Retrofit sensor kits can convert existing manual systems into touchless flush systems.
Which flush system lasts longer?
Manual systems may last longer mechanically because they have fewer electronic parts. However, modern commercial automatic systems are highly durable when properly maintained.
